Unless you’re overrun with sweetgum then I wouldn’t worry about spraying again. The stuff your about to kill is most likely the very stuff you want to be growing for deer right now. There’s plenty of loblolly grown every year that doesn’t get sprayed clean. Don’t get me wrong, it’ll definitely help the trees get a jump start to kill of the other stuff….but it’s not really the trees that are providing your deer with cover and food right now….it’s the other stuff. Those loblolly will be over head high in a couple years even if you don’t spray….they aren’t gonna get choked out.
